Day 20: The Good In Front of Me

Reflection by Jacquelyne Rocan

Do I thank God for my present situation?  

There are times when I wish that my life would be different from what I am currently experiencing.  I long to be married again, have children, and be able to enjoy more time for travel and relaxation rather than working full-time.  I imagine what my life might look like, and I always imagine that it would be better and more fulfilling than my current life.  

When I engage in this magical thinking, I have learned to stop myself and take a moment to say a prayer of gratitude for the life that I have, the people that I am blessed to have in my life, and the situations that I have the opportunity to experience.  It is easy to assume that life would be better if my circumstances would be different, but this assumption reflects a lack of trust in God and of His will for my life.  I recall the words from the Prophet Jeremiah:  “For I know well the plans I have in mind for you – oracle of the LORD – plans for your welfare and not for woe, so as to give you a future of hope” (Jeremiah 29:11).

If I keep hoping and wishing for a different life, I will fail to recognize and appreciate all of the good that God has done and continues to do for me.  God knows what is best — I need to simply trust and keep moving forward.

How have I thanked God for my present state in life today?  

Thank you, God, for all of the blessings and gifts that You have bestowed on me.  Please increase my trust in Your will for me and keep me ever grateful for my life and the people you place in my life that help me grow in faith, hope, and love.  Authentically Yours.
